Output dca9e1385baebe0d7909013574af7eeea8a389a16dfd96718f8400a6b4f49b4d:0

value
595981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0566f6e9b1b62dc282e28ed07b1765a85bcdfc71 OP_EQUAL
address
32BaebsTE8bG1DamxiS5qu8hyv3BsMcmkE
transaction
dca9e1385baebe0d7909013574af7eeea8a389a16dfd96718f8400a6b4f49b4d
confirmations
161778
spent
true